Predicted to enable RNA polymerase II transcription regulatory region sequence-specific DNA binding activity and promoter-specific chromatin binding activity. Predicted to be involved in several processes, including negative regulation of G1/S transition of mitotic cell cycle; negative regulation of cellular senescence; and regulation of lipid kinase activity. Predicted to act upstream of or within negative regulation of gene expression and negative regulation of transcription by RNA polymerase II. Predicted to be located in nucleoplasm. Predicted to be part of transcription regulator complex. Predicted to be active in chromatin. Orthologous to human RBL1 (RB transcriptional corepressor like 1).
